I have completed my b.tech in 2016.
Now i want to do PG in economics for college lecturer 
Can i do it ?

Yes you can do PG in any stream but for college lecturer you have to clear NET.

Greetings Vinod. 
Let me tell you my academic story. I did B Tech in Mechanical Engineering from ISM Dhanbad (now IIT ISM Dhanbad) in year 2011. I did MA in PUblic Administration from SHekhawati university in 2017 and qualified NET in NOv 2017. So there is no issue in doing PG in Economics. I don't know from where you belong, but in my state minimum 55% is required in PG course with NET/SLET qualification to become eligible for college lecturer. You must fulfill that criteria. If you are doing any job and want to carry on your studies, you can get yourself admitted in IGNOU or VMOU (open universities). The advantage of selecting open universities is that they provide complete study material and flexibility of attending exam with extended years. The course material provided by open universities is even referred by IAS aspirants for preparing mains subjects. I have also done PG diploma in Disaster management from IGNOU.
